akcipher_request_set_crypt(child_req, &sg, &sg, slen, slen); This causes the underlying hardware driver to DMA-map the same physical buffer twice with incompatible directions (DMA_TO_DEVICE and DMA_FROM_DEVICE), which is undefined behaviour on non-coherent architectures and leads to intermittent cache-coherency failures. dma_map_sg(dev, fixup_src, src_nents, DMA_TO_DEVICE); dma_map_sg(dev, req->dst, dst_nents, DMA_FROM_DEVICE); On non-coherent ARM64 platforms (e.g. i.MX8 with CAAM), the DMA_FROM_DEVICE mapping invalidates CPU cache lines covering the buffer after the DMA_TO_DEVICE mapping has flushed them but before the hardware reads the data. This produces a race that intermittently corrupts the RSA input, causing the EMSA-PKCS1-v1_5 structure check or digest comparison to fail with -EKEYREJECTED. Fix by allocating separate input and output buffers so each DMA mapping covers a distinct physical region, matching the approach used by the predecessor pkcs1pad template.
